Handover note — Crumbwheel order cutoffs.

Welcome aboard. The bakery cutoff rule in Crumbwheel closes same-day orders at 14:00 local to each storefront, not UTC — this has bitten us twice. Holiday overrides live in the calendar service and take precedence silently, so always check there first when a cutoff looks wrong. To unlock the calendar service's admin console after a restart, enter the recovery passphrase below.

vault phrase of bagap-bahaf = silion-pelox-sorox-casdor-quenwyn-fraax-eliox-praael-kelion-quenvan-kasox-rusael-norius-belvan

Handover Note — Quarterly Cash-Flow Forecast

For the heads of department, from outgoing director Elsa Marwick to incoming director Joren Falt. The Q2 forecast for Bramblehurst Foods stands as circulated: net inflows steady, with the seasonal dip in the Tarnwick bakery line offset by prepayments from the Avelorn distribution deal. Collections discipline improved after the new dunning process. Capital spend is deferred to Q3 except the chiller replacement. Keep weekly variance reviews running. The forward business context is set out below.

management briefing: Project Istwyn slips by one quarter because of the staffing delay.

## Service Account: garage-feed-reader

This account polls the Oakhollow parking-garage occupancy feed every 30 seconds and publishes counts to the internal Stallwatch dashboard. Scope is read-only on the feed endpoint; it holds no write permissions anywhere. Rotation occurs every 90 days, enforced by the vault policy. For this security review, the currently active credential is recorded below.

app token of kafop-hahaf = kto11_iRLdsMBafGn